NAD kinase 2, mitochondrial; mitochondrial NAD kinase; NAD kinase domain-containing protein 1, mitochondrial (NADK2, C5orf33, MNADK, NADKD1)

Function: - mitochondrial NAD+ kinase - phosphorylates NAD+ to yield NADP+ - can use both ATP or inorganic polyphosphate as the phosphoryl donor - also has weak NADH kinase activity in vitro; however NADH kinase activity is much weaker than the NAD+ kinase activity & may not be relevant in vivo ATP + NAD+ = ADP + NADP+ Kinetic parameters: - KM=0.022 mM for NAD+ - KM=1.7 mM for ATP - KM=1.2 mM for tetrapolyphosphate - Vmax=0.091 umol/min/mg enzyme Inhibition: - inhibited by NADH, NADPH & NADP+ Structure: - homodimer (probable) - belongs to the NAD kinase family Compartment: mitochondria Alternative splicing: named isoforms=3 Expression: widely expressed
